Join a startup in the hottest new role in town.

At Jumpstart, we help ambitious ex-consultants, bankers, and founders land roles at the UK's most exciting VC-backed startups as a Commercial Associate or Commercial Generalist.

This isn't a standard sales role. Startups don't have a playbook or set way of selling to customers – you'll come in and start owning deals from day one, as well as setting up and defining how the startup makes revenue, who they sell to, and working with the product team to refine what they sell. This is one of the most sought-after roles in startups at the moment.

  • Owning accounts and closing deals – Running outbound, demos, and closing deals with often very senior and high-powered customers.
  • Being entrepreneurial with outreach – A great CA uses thought leadership, events, precisely targeted messaging, and marketing, as well as traditional sales tactics, to get clients interested on behalf of the startup.
  • Using data and analysis to refine decision-making – In startups, there is no playbook. You'll need to dig into the data, work out who the ideal customer is, and A/B test different tactics and initiatives to see what works.
  • Working with product and tech leaders – At such an early stage, a CA will be actively liaising between customers and tech teams to evolve the product in a way that suits customers.
  • Building new channels & growth initiatives – Coming up with new methods and strategies to build revenue and pipeline for your startup.
  • Implementing AI & automation across the stack – Use agents, LLMs, and automation tools to make the GTM function more effective and improve performance.
